PhilHealth Agreement Number: What It Is and Why It Matters
If you`ve ever had to deal with health insurance in the Philippines, you`ve probably heard of the PhilHealth Agreement Number (PAN). But what exactly is it, and why is it important?
First of all, let`s define what PhilHealth is. The Philippine Health Insurance Corporation (PhilHealth) is a government-owned and controlled corporation that provides health insurance to Filipinos. It is mandatory for all employees and voluntary for self-employed individuals and professionals.
Now, the PhilHealth Agreement Number is a unique identifier that is assigned to each member of PhilHealth. It is a 12-digit number that is used to track a member`s contributions and benefits. The PAN is printed on your PhilHealth ID card, which you should carry with you at all times.
Why is the PhilHealth Agreement Number important? For one, it ensures that your contributions are properly credited to your PhilHealth account. Without a PAN, your contributions may not be properly recorded, which can lead to problems when you need to avail of PhilHealth benefits.
In addition, the PAN is also important when you need to make updates or changes to your PhilHealth membership. For example, if you get married or change your name, you will need to update your PhilHealth records. Your PAN will be used to confirm your identity and ensure that the changes are made to the correct account.
Another reason why the PhilHealth Agreement Number is important is because it can be used to check the status of your PhilHealth membership. You can use the PhilHealth online portal or visit a PhilHealth office to check your contributions, benefits, and other details related to your membership. Having your PAN handy will make it easier to access these services.
